Nanodevices for Food-Borne Pathogens and Toxin Detection
摘要
Foodborne pathogens and toxins not only reduce the quality of food, but also generate a serious threat to human health. Therefore, it is very significant to identify these pathogens and toxins before consumption of foods. The traditional methods used for this purpose are time waster and expensive, and the reliability of the results becomes controversial. Nanotechnology is widely used in food science and food technology today. Among the most notable of these applications are nanodevices such as nanosensors. Studies with nanodevices used in the determination of foodborne pathogens and toxins are interesting. Nanodevices used for this purpose have started to be used today in terms of ease of use, allowing selective analysis, giving results in a short time and obtaining reliable results. Within the scope of this book chapter, it is aimed to provide information about foodborne pathogens, toxins, and nanodevices used in the determination of these compounds.
